If you have a sweet tooth, we’ve got some great news to share. After finding success in Alberta and Ontario last summer, Crumbl Cookies is finally opening its first location in BC. And while details are a little scarce at the moment, this is definitely an announcement we’ve been looking forward to sinking our teeth into.
Known for its signature chocolate chip cookie, Crumbl has over 700 bakeries worldwide, and over 200 rotating cookie flavours inspired by everything from cakes and pies to cereal and candy.
From drool-worthy desserts like Snickerdoodle, banana bread and strawberry cupcake to waffle and peanut butter-covered eats, we can’t wait to see what they’ll offer at the new BC location.

In an email with Curiocity, a representative from Crumbl shares that the Port Coquitlam location (1125 Nicola Avenue) will open “early to late summer.”
So there you have it, Vancouver. Stay tuned for more delicious details as they come, including an official opening date and menu offerings.
